I. Full Liquid-Cooling Technology
1. Fast Heat Dissipation, High Efficiency, and Stability
Using advanced liquid-cooling technology, it quickly removes heat via circulating coolant, ensuring continuous stable operation in high-heat environments. Cooling efficiency is about 30% higher than traditional air cooling. With the supercharging terminal, it achieves 600A output for a “one kilometer per second” experience. It avoids power reduction or shutdown caused by overheating, providing more reliable services.

2. Silent Operation, Environmentally Friendly
The air-ductless design isolates cooling parts from electrical ones, blocking salt spray and dust. Operating noise is below 55dB, creating a comfortable environment, ideal for residential and commercial areas with high noise requirements.
3. Liquid-Electric Isolation, Safe and Reliable
Coolant is completely isolated from live parts, eliminating leakage or short-circuit risks. It features multi-layer protection including overvoltage, undervoltage, short-circuit, grounding, and overtemperature protection.
4. Intelligent Power Allocation, Improving Efficiency
Smart scheduling adjusts output based on vehicle needs, battery status, and priority. In multi-car charging, it ensures optimal ways for each car, avoiding delays due to insufficient power.

5. Modular Design, Flexible Expansion and Maintenance
Modular units allow flexible configuration and expansion as needed, reducing initial investment. Individual modules can be replaced without stopping the whole station, shortening maintenance time.
6. Strong Weather Resistance for Harsh Environments
High protection ratings resist dust, rain, and snow, suitable for coastal or high-heat scenarios. Cabinets feature special coatings to prevent salt spray corrosion.
II. Wide Application, Accurate Matching of Needs
1. Urban Public Charging Stations: Smart and Flexible
Supports multi-gun charging with dynamic adjustment. During peaks, it prioritizes low-battery vehicles for faster replenishment and better overall efficiency.
2. Highway Service Areas: Ultra-fast Charging, Ultimate Experience
With 600A output, it achieves 80% charge in 10 minutes for a 500km range EV, greatly easing range anxiety.
3. Community and Commercial Parking: Safe and Green
Intelligently adjusts current based on BMS feedback. Features sleep mode with power consumption below 20W for the host, saving energy. Supports multiple starting ways like cards, codes, or APPs.
4. Industrial Parks and Logistics Centers: Ultra-high Power
Provides up to 600kW per gun, meeting needs of large buses, engineering vehicles, and trucks. It can interface with storage systems for peak shaving and lower costs.
